Demian Gawianski

is a teacher of Spanish as a Second Language in Buenos Aires, Argentina. Also fluent in English, French, and Portugese, he is dedicated to the study of different languages and cultures, currently studying German, Old Greek, Latin, and Sanskrit. He taught workshops on the language and culture of tango in the USA in 2007 and also in 2009 and at the New Zealand Tango Festival in 2008.

Listen to and translate the iconic tango song "Malena". Translation will have a focus on the culture of tango as revealed in the tango lyrics. Previous Spanish knowledge not required for his 90-minute free class at 13:00 on Saturday.

Gawianski will present his books on Friday and Saturday night at the tangoballs. His first book is Buenos Aires Experience, Enjoy the Tango of Learning Spanish. It is an Argentine Spanish language course book with 2 CDs, mainly addressed to English speaking Tango lovers who want to learn the language in combination with Tango poetry and with the culture of the city. He has also translated the book of poems Listening Inside the Dance: A Beginners Journey into Tango, by 2006-Poet Laureate of Belfast, Maine, Elizabeth Garber.
